ENG 104 - Introduction to Language and Literature I and II

Institution:
Holyoke Community College
Subject:
Description:
Covers the ability to communicate with others, to think critically, and to comprehend works of literature and nonfiction. Emphasis is on expository writing; writing critically about fiction, drama, and poetry; the research process; and on acquiring word processing and other appropriate computer skills. Frequent short essays are assigned, amounting to a total of approximately six thousand words during the semester. Prerequisite: Appropriate score on English Placement Tests or completion of ENG 097 and/or ENG 098 with a grade of C- or better, or ENG 096 or ENG 099 with a grade of C- or better. 4 Contact hours
